2022 World Cup | The Spanish Way
Daniel and Have Hope discuss Spain's exit from the World Cup at the hands of Morocco. Is there a way to play "Spanish football" without having a great striker? Can culture be changed? If so, should it be changed? If Brazil doesn't make you happy, why are you even here? Would France winning this World Cup make "football sense?" The psychology of penalties, and some predictions for the quarter-finals. Also, Eden Hazard retires from international football at age 31.
